The parties hereby stipulate as follows:
2
WHEREAS, Defendant Beverly Health and Rehabilitation Services, Inc. filed a Motion to
3 Dismiss Pursuant to F.R.C.P. 12(B)(6) (“Motion to Dismiss”), which has been fully-briefed by all
4 parties;
5
WHEREAS, since the filing of the Motion to Dismiss but prior to it being heard, the
6 parties agreed to engage in private mediation with Mr. Michael Loeb at JAMS in San Francisco.
7 The parties were scheduled to engage in mediation with Mr. Loeb on December 18, 2012. In
8 anticipation of the mediation, the parties exchanged a statistically significant sample of
9 documentation and information in order to allow the parties to prepare and engage in a meaningful
10 and productive mediation. The complete review and analysis of the produced data, however,
11 could not be completed and reviewed by the initial December 18, 2012, mediation date. Thus, the
12 mediation was postponed.
13
WHEREAS, the parties are in the process of continuing to review and analyze the
14 documentation and information that has been produced by Defendant. Additionally, Alan Harris,
15 lead counsel for the Plaintiff, has been engaged in trial preparation and trial and has been unable to
16 reschedule the mediation prior to January 17, 2013, the parties’ current deadline to complete
17 mediation;
18
IT IS THEREFORE STIPULATED AND AGREED, in order to allow the parties to
19 reschedule a mutually-convenient date for mediation, the parties have stipulated to continuing
20 their deadline to mediate with Mr. Loeb until February 28, 2013. The parties further stipulate to
21 continue the hearing on the Motion to Dismiss and the Case Management Conference until March
22 14, 2013, at 1:30 p.m. in Courtroom 5, 17th Floor, San Francisco, if that date is convenient to the
23 Court. The parties shall file a Joint Case Management Statement at least one week prior to the
24 Case Management Conference.
